LED Wrap Fixtures for Commercial and Institutional Interior Spaces

Commercial LED Wrap Lighting for Corridors, Offices, and Support Areas

LED wrap fixtures are widely specified in commercial and institutional environments where uniform illumination, glare control, and long-term efficiency are required. These luminaires are commonly installed in corridors, offices, utility rooms, classrooms, healthcare support areas, and back-of-house spaces where consistent light distribution and low maintenance directly support daily operations.

Modern LED wraparound lights combine diffused optics with high-efficacy LED systems, making them a practical solution for facilities focused on reliability, energy performance, and visual comfort.

Commercial Applications for LED Wrap Fixtures

  • Office corridors and circulation paths
  • Stairwells and egress routes
  • Utility rooms and mechanical spaces
  • Storage areas and supply rooms
  • Educational and healthcare support areas

Wrap fixtures are typically selected where recessed ceiling systems are unavailable or where surface-mounted luminaires are preferred for serviceability and durability.

Primary Types of Commercial LED Wrap Fixtures

Fixture Type Mounting Method Best Use Cases Key Considerations
Surface-Mounted LED Wrap Direct mount to ceiling or wall Retrofits, concrete decks, utility spaces Fast installation, accessible servicing
Recessed LED Wrap Installed within ceiling cavity Finished interiors, narrow corridors Requires ceiling coordination and plenum clearance
Suspended LED Wrap Cable or stem suspension Higher ceilings, open support areas Mounting height drives spacing and glare control

Photometric Performance and Visual Comfort

Commercial wrap fixtures are designed to deliver consistent illumination across horizontal and vertical planes. Performance should be evaluated using fixture-level photometric data, especially in corridors and circulation areas where uniformity impacts safety and comfort.

Performance Metric Typical Range Design Impact
Lumen Output 2,500 – 6,000 lumens Determines spacing, fixture count, and target foot-candle levels
Distribution Wide, diffuse Reduces contrast and supports consistent coverage
Glare Control Continuous diffused lens Improves comfort in high-traffic interior areas

Energy Efficiency and Electrical Characteristics

Modern commercial wrap fixtures utilize integrated LED systems designed for efficiency, control compatibility, and long-term performance.

Specification Commercial Standard What to Verify
Efficacy 120–150 lm/W Higher lm/W reduces wattage needed to hit target light levels
Input Voltage 120–277V universal Compatibility with existing commercial electrical systems
Dimming 0–10V standard Driver compatibility with controls and sensor strategies
Qualification DLC listed (where applicable) Rebate eligibility and spec-grade documentation

Color Temperature Selection for Commercial Interiors

CCT Best-Fit Areas Why It’s Commonly Specified
3500K Transitional and mixed-use areas Balanced tone for spaces that blend comfort and visibility
4000K Offices, corridors, classrooms Neutral white that supports general circulation and task visibility
5000K Utility and mechanical spaces Higher visual clarity where detail work and inspections occur

Controls and Automation Compatibility

Wrap fixtures are frequently integrated into broader lighting control strategies, especially in commercial lighting environments where code compliance and operating cost control are priorities.

  • Occupancy sensors to reduce runtime in low-traffic areas
  • Daylight-responsive dimming where perimeter daylight is present
  • 0–10V control integration for centralized building strategies

Installation and Maintenance Best Practices

Consideration Best Practice Why It Helps
Mounting & Layout Use consistent spacing and align fixtures to the circulation path Improves uniformity and reduces dark zones
Service Access Choose fixtures with accessible drivers and tool-less lens options where possible Reduces labor time during inspections or component replacement
Lens Maintenance Clean lenses routinely in dusty or high-traffic corridors Maintains delivered lumens and visual consistency
Controls Commissioning Verify dimming and sensor settings during startup Prevents nuisance switching and improves occupant comfort
